π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

16 items
  • 4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 large eggs
  • 0.25 cup whole mil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 1.5 cups dried figs, finely chopped
  • 1 cup dates, finely chopped and pitted
  • 0.5 cup raisins
  • 0.5 cup mini chocolate chips
  • 1 tablespoon orange zest
  • 0.25 cup honey
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1 large egg, lightly beaten (for egg wash)

πŸ“ Instructions

12 steps
1

In a large mixing b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, salt, and baking powder.

2

Add the softened butter into the dry ingredients and mix until the texture resembles coarse crumbs.

3

In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, and vanilla extract. Gradually add this mixture to the dry ingredients and mix until a dough forms. Divide the dough into two equal parts, wrap them in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.

4

While the dough is chilling, prepare the filling. In a food processor, combine the chopped figs, dates, raisins, chocolate chips, orange zest, honey, and ground cinnamon. Pulse the mixture until it forms a cohesive, spreadable filling.

5

Preheat the o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.

6

On a lightly floured surface, roll out one portion of dough into a rectangle, approximately 12 inches by 8 inches. Spread half of the fruit and chocolate filling evenly over the dough, leaving a 1-inch border on all sides.

7

Starting from the long edge, carefully roll the dough into a tight log. Pinch the seams and ends to seal. Repeat with the second portion of dough and the remaining filling.

8

Transfer the logs seam-side down to the prepared baking sheets. Use a sharp knife to make shallow diagonal cuts along the top of each log, ensuring not to cut all the way through the dough.

9

Brush the tops of the logs with the beaten egg to create a golden finish during baking.

10

Bake in the preheated oven for 18–20 minutes, or until the logs are lightly golden brown and firm to the touch.

11

Remove the logs from the oven and allow them to cool completely on a wire rack.

12

Once cooled, slice the logs into individual cookies, approximately 1-inch thick, and serve. Store in an airtight container for up to a week.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(74.4g)
Calories
271
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 9.9 g 13%
Saturated Fat 5.9 g 29%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 45 mg 15%
Sodium 98 mg 4%
Total Carbohydrate 43.1 g 16%
Dietary Fiber 2.6 g 9%
Total Sugars 23.7 g
Protein 3.9 g 8%
Vitamin D 0.3 mcg 1%
Calcium 32 mg 2%
Iron 1.4 mg 8%
Potassium 185 mg 4%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
